1 definition by agirlprovingherpoint

one who repeatedly corrects and/or mocks his or her friends, thinking of him or herself as a genius who knows all
When I told him I can do what I want, that buttmunch replied with "well, i say you can't, so ha!"
by agirlprovingherpoint March 19, 2009